Abstract

The utility model discloses an ultrasonic water meter of removable battery, characterized by: comprises an upper shell and a lower shell which are detachably connected up and down; the upper shell comprises a cover body and a circuit board mounting bin, and the circuit board mounting bin is mounted in the cover body and used for mounting a circuit board; the lower shell comprises a bottom shell and a mounting plate, wherein battery mounting bins are formed in the bottom shell and on the mounting plate, and the mounting plate is arranged at an upper opening of the bottom shell; the two side walls of the cover body are provided with limiting walls, the two side walls of the bottom shell are provided with mounting openings, and the limiting walls are matched in the mounting openings and form mounting holes for pipelines to pass through. The utility model discloses can change the battery, and can not destroy the waterproof performance of water gauge, the continuation of the water gauge of being convenient for is used.

Background
The ultrasonic water meter is a novel water meter which further calculates the flow of the outlet water by detecting the time difference generated by the change of the speed when the ultrasonic sound beam propagates in the downstream and the upstream in the water and analyzing and processing the flow to obtain the flow rate of the outlet water. The method is characterized by low initial flow velocity, wide range ratio, high measurement precision and stable work; the inner part has no moving part and no flow resisting element, is not influenced by impurities in water and has long service life. The output communication function is complete, and various communication and wireless networking requirements are met; the water meter has excellent small-flow detection capability, can solve the problems of a plurality of traditional water meters, is more suitable for water-rate gradient charging, is more suitable for saving and reasonably utilizing water resources, and has wide market and use prospects.
In the prior art, 2 batteries are placed at most in a common ultrasonic water meter, and the batteries cannot be replaced. Because battery installation storehouse and circuit board storehouse are same installation storehouse, change the waterproof nature that the battery can destroy the water gauge, destroyed the whole of water gauge basically to lead to the water gauge can not continue to use.

Detailed Description
The ultrasonic water meter with replaceable battery of the present invention will be further described with reference to fig. 1 to 5.
An ultrasonic water meter with a replaceable battery is characterized in that: comprises an upper shell 1 and a lower shell 2 which are detachably connected up and down;
the upper shell 1 comprises a cover body 11 and a circuit board mounting bin 12, the cover body 11 and the circuit board mounting bin 12 are both provided with lower openings, and the circuit board mounting bin 12 is mounted on the top wall in the cover body 11 and used for mounting the circuit board 3;
the lower shell 2 comprises a bottom shell 22 and a mounting plate 21, the bottom shell 22 is provided with an upper opening for butting and mounting the lower opening, the battery mounting bin 5 is formed in the bottom shell 22 and on the mounting plate 21, and the mounting plate 21 is arranged on the upper opening of the bottom shell 22;
the two side walls of the cover body 11 are provided with limiting walls 112, the two side walls of the bottom shell 22 are provided with mounting openings 223, and the limiting walls 112 are fitted in the mounting openings 223 and form mounting holes for the pipeline to pass through.
As described above, when the amount of electricity of the battery 4 is used up, the cover body 11 and the mounting plate 21 can be detached to replace the battery in the battery mounting compartment 5. Because the circuit board 3 is installed in the circuit board installation bin 12, the circuit board and the battery do not interfere with each other (are connected only through a lead), and therefore the circuit board is not affected in the process of replacing the battery. That is, when the cover body 11 is detached, the circuit board mounting compartment is directly detached from the lower case 2 together with the cover body 11, and the battery mounting compartment 5 is located in the lower case 2, so that the circuit board is not affected by the replacement of the battery. The utility model discloses in, the circuit board carries out the encapsulating and handles in circuit board installation storehouse 12 interior installation back, realizes the sealed water-proof effects of circuit board in circuit board installation storehouse 12, draws forth the wire simultaneously from the circuit board and is connected to battery installation storehouse 5 to make the circuit board accept the power supply of installing the battery in battery installation storehouse.
The embodiment is further configured as follows: a first connecting pipe 112 extending up and down is formed on the inner wall of the cover body 11, a second connecting pipe 221 extending up and down is formed on the inner wall of the bottom shell 22, an inner step 2211 is formed on the inner wall of the second connecting pipe 221, the first connecting pipe 112 and the second connecting pipe 221 are butted and fixed through a bolt, when the upper shell 1 and the lower shell 2 are assembled, the lower end of the first connecting pipe 112 is inserted into the upper end of the second connecting pipe 221, the lower end of the first connecting pipe 112 abuts against the inner step 2211, the bolt penetrates through the step 222 from bottom to top into the first connecting pipe 112 to realize the connection of the cover body 11 on the bottom shell 22, and a pipe orifice at the lower end of the second connecting pipe is positioned on the outer wall of the bottom shell; in this embodiment, the first connection pipe 112 and the second connection pipe 221 each have four parts and are located at four corners of the water meter. This connection mode can realize the removable setting between the drain pan 22 of the cover body 11, is convenient for the change of battery to and still can guarantee cover body 11 and drain pan 22 structural strength under connected state.
The embodiment is further configured as follows: a third connecting pipe 111 extends downwards from the top wall of the cover body 11, a connecting lug 121 is formed on the outer wall of the circuit board mounting bin 12, and the connecting hole of the connecting lug 121 is in butt joint with the connecting hole of the third connecting pipe 111 and is fixed through a bolt. With the structure, the circuit board mounting bin 12 can be detachably mounted in the cover body 11.
The embodiment is further configured as follows: mounting bar 122 has on the inner wall of circuit board installation storehouse 12, the mounting groove that the border card that supplies the circuit board was gone into has on the lateral wall of mounting bar 122, and equal shaping has the mounting bar on four inner walls of circuit board installation storehouse 12 promptly, all has the mounting groove on every mounting bar, goes into four borders cards of circuit board and to realize the installation of circuit board in circuit board installation storehouse 12 in the mounting groove of mounting bar all around, and the circuit board clamps the completion back, carries out the encapsulating again and handles, carries out waterproof sealing. The installation of the circuit board in the circuit board installation bin 12 can be obviously made things convenient for in the setting of mounting bar and mounting groove, but also can guarantee the stability of installation.
The embodiment is further configured as follows: the battery installation bin 5 is divided into a battery transverse installation groove 51 and a battery vertical installation groove 52;
the battery transverse installation grooves 51 are three and are respectively positioned in the installation plate 21 and the bottom shell;
the battery vertical mounting groove 52 has one and is located in the bottom case 22.
The battery installation bin 5 is divided into a battery transverse installation groove 51 and a battery vertical installation groove 52, so that the space in the installation plate 21 and the bottom shell 22 can be reasonably utilized, and the batteries can be conveniently distributed and installed; on the other hand, the horizontal mounting groove 51 of battery and the total number of the vertical mounting groove 52 of battery with be four, consequently the utility model discloses can supply the installation of four sections lithium cells, wherein two sections are used for the communication power supply, and two sections are used for the measurement power supply in addition for the electric quantity of battery obtains reasonable distribution and uses, has prolonged the utility model discloses a normal use time.
The embodiment is further configured as follows: the bottom of the battery transverse installation groove 51 is provided in a semicircular shape 511. The lithium cell is the cylinder, and consequently this setting can play the effect of location to the lithium cell, when the lithium cell dress in battery installation storehouse 5, equally need the encapsulating to handle, both can seal, still can fix.
The embodiment further provides that a step 222 is formed on the upper opening wall of the bottom shell, the lower opening of the cover body is matched with the upper opening of the bottom shell to form a clamping groove 6, and the peripheral edge of the mounting plate 21 is clamped in the clamping groove 6.
The embodiment is further configured as follows: the lower surface of mounting panel 21 has the locating plate through bolted connection, and this locating plate is used for fixing the pipeline of installation to the drain pan in, passes through the bolt location between pipeline and this locating plate promptly.
